IEC 62333-3:2010 provides characterization of parameters for electromagnetic noise suppression sheet (NSS) for digital devices and equipment used in a frequency range between 30 MHz to 30 GHz. Guidance is given for uniform presentation of the properties of noise suppression sheet, intended for use in manufacturers and users technical data. NSS suppresses noise at its source, rather than absorbing noise at a distance. Therefore NSS is distinguished from RF wave absorbers used in free space. This standard addresses the following purposes of NSS manufacturers and users: - it assists users in understanding the published technical data in catalogues; - it guides users in selecting the most preferable NSS for each application; - it establishes measurement benchmarking for manufacturers of performance in new development of NSS; and - it maintains high reliability of NSS and applied products. The numerical values given in this standard are typical values of parameters (properties) of the related NSS. The purpose of NSS testing is the benchmarking of materials. Predictions of specific device performance values are not always easy or even possible. Every detailed material and NSS specification should be agreed between the user and the manufacturer.

IEC 62333-3:2010 is an international standard developed by the International Electrotechnical Commission (IEC) that focuses on the characterization of parameters for electromagnetic noise suppression sheets (NSS) used in digital devices and equipment. This standard applies to NSS operating within a wide frequency range from 30 MHz to 30 GHz. It complements the IEC 62333 series by providing detailed guidance for manufacturers and users on the technical properties and performance benchmark testing of noise suppression sheets.
The key objective of IEC 62333-3:2010 is to support consistent and reliable measurement and presentation of NSS properties. It ensures that noise suppression sheets effectively reduce electromagnetic noise at the source, distinguishing these materials from RF wave absorbers designed for free-space noise reduction.
Key Topics
-
Scope and Purpose IEC 62333-3 outlines parameters for characterizing noise suppression sheets used in digital devices, assisting users in understanding technical data and guiding manufacturers in developing high-quality NSS products. It supports uniform benchmarking for material properties and physical structure.
-
Material Properties Important parameters include:
- Surface resistivity measured in ohms per square, indicating electrical resistance on the NSS surface, determined according to IEC 60093.
- Mechanical characteristics such as density, Young’s modulus, and hardness, which influence durability and mechanical integrity. Density is measured per ISO 1183-1 standards.
- Thermal properties including thermal conductivity and thermal expansion coefficients, critical for performance under varying temperature conditions.
- Environmental conditions encompassing operating temperature range, storage temperature, and flammability ratings to ensure reliability in diverse application environments.
-
Structural Parameters
- Thickness of the noise suppression sheet, affecting noise attenuation and physical integration.
- Layer structure detailing the composition and arrangement of layers within the NSS, which impacts electromagnetic characteristics.
-
Measurement Methods The standard specifies methods to uniformly measure each parameter, providing clear instructions for material testing and data reporting. These methodologies foster comparability and reliability across different NSS manufacturers and users.
-
Limitations Numerical values offered are typical reference values used for benchmarking rather than definitive performance guarantees. Specific device performance predictions should be jointly agreed upon between the user and manufacturer.

Related Standards
IEC 62333-3:2010 works in conjunction with other parts of the IEC 62333 series:
- IEC 62333-1 - Provides general guidelines, definitions, and overall framework for noise suppression sheets.
- IEC 62333-2 - Establishes the measurement methods for key suppression ratios in noise suppression sheets, crucial for assessing NSS effectiveness against electromagnetic interference.
Additionally, referenced international standards for testing and measurement include:
- IEC 60068 series for environmental testing
- IEC 60093 for surface resistivity measurements
- ISO 527-1 for tensile properties of plastics
- ISO 1183-1 for density measurement
- ISO 22007 series for thermal conductivity and diffusivity
